OK that makes sense. I don't have a floppy on this machine either, so it doesn't matter. I do know that for the Win XP or most restoration disks you need to have the cd-rom bootable and the HD in master. It seems impossible to do that with the e-pc.

Apparantly, HP has made it so you have to buy a proprietar kit that goes with these machines to use a slim drive. It has a little adapter that fits onto the appropriate slimdrive. So if I bought just the drive from 3rd party, it probably wouldn't work.
